The hexadecimal color code #8078B6 corresponds to the code RGB( 128, 120, 182 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,50 level), green (at 0,47 level) and blue (at 0,71 level). Its brightness is 59% and its saturation is 29%. It is composed of red at 29%, green at 27% and blue at 42%.
